Could you post your Computer's DxDiag?
- Press Windows-Key + R
- Type: DxDiag
- Click on Save all Information.
- Attach the Text File to your post

I followed the steps to create a new game version. Just rename your Sims 4 folder to "Sims 4 Backup" or smth like that, then launch the game again which makes it create a new version of the game. You'll still have your saves & trays in the "backup" one, but launch the game WITHOUT them first & see if you get to the main menu. Just google "how to create new game version sims 4" & it'll give you the steps on how to do it 😊 I was able to get to the main menu after doing this at least. But only if I did it vanilla, I believe UI Cheats was broken unfortunately & likely some others too.
